How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al Actually Works
When a fire sprinkler discharges water, it can cause significant damage to your property. Our process is designed to mitigate that damage and get your home back to normal as quickly as possible. We’ll start by assessing the extent of the damage, then move on to extracting the water and drying your space. This may involve using specialized equipment like wet/dry vacuums and desiccants to speed up the drying process.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ll begin by assessing the damage to your property, identifying areas that need attention, and developing a customized plan to restore your home. Our team will work closely with you to understand your needs and concerns, ensuring that you’re always informed and involved in the process.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Next, we’ll use our specialized equipment to extract the water from your property, including wet/dry vacuums and pumps. Our goal is to remove as much water as possible to prevent further damage and promote drying.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is extracted, we’ll use desiccants and dehumidifiers to dry your space and prevent mold growth. This step is critical in preventing long-term damage and ensuring a healthy living environment.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Finally, we’ll clean and sanitize your property to remove any remaining debris, bacteria, or other contaminants. This step is essential in ensuring that your home is safe and healthy for you and your family.

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al Cost in Hickory Creek, TX
The cost of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Hickory Creek, TX.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, amount of water extracted |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of drying process |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, extent of cleaning required |
| Structural Rep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| Severity of structural damage, complexity of repair |
| Mold Remediation | $1,500 – $6,000 | Size of affected area, extent of mold growth |
| HVAC System Cleaning |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of cleaning required |
